This property is not currently for sale or for rent on Trulia. The description and property data below may have been provided by a third party, the homeowner or public records.
The 1,017 sq ft condo has recently been renovated and is ready for your immediate move-in. The kitchen is outfitted with a new electric washer, dryer, dishwasher, refrigerator, and microwave for the tenant's convenience. The property is near the following schools: Suburban Park Elementary K-5, Northside Middle School 6-8, and Granby High 9-12 or within 6 miles to Old Dominion University, Eastern Virginia Medical School or Norfolk State University. Looking for things to do? The condo is located a few miles to the Oceanview Beach Park, Tidewater Arboretum, Nauticus, Norfolk Botanical Garden, or Virginia Zoo. Close to following military bases: Norfolk Naval Air Station and Norfolk Naval Base.
Owner pays for water. Renter is responsible for electric. Applicant is subject to credit check.
